1 banana
1 tbsp unsalted butter, softened
2 tbsp firmly packed brown sugar
2 tbsp lightly toasted pecans
1/4 cp flour
1/4 tsp baking powder
1/2 tsp ground cardamom
3 tbsp sugar
1 egg
1/4 tsp vanilla
Instructions
1 - In small saucepan melt 2 tbsp butter and split between 2 1 cup ramekins
2 - Sprinkle brown sugar and pecans over butter
3 - Slice banana into 1/4" thick slices and arrange over pecans
overlapping and lightly pressing to fit
4 - In a small bowl whisk together flour, baking powder, cardamom
and a pinch of salt
5 - In another bowl beat together the remnaining butter and sugar
until mixed well.
6 - Beat in the egg and vanilla, then beat in the flour mixture until
just combined.
7 - Divide the batter between the two ramekinsand bake on a baking sheet
in the middle of the oven about 25 minutes (or until an inserted toothpick
comes out clean.)
8 - Use a sharp knife to loosen the cake from the inside surface, then
invert on plates to serve.
